Output 58b8266e4eb4680f340c1455a4ec3373afcf8471bcf9ff28f3e97d36a7a5a02b:3

value
530334
script pubkey
OP_0 OP_PUSHBYTES_20 810de59a46122a6b5fd8058871e1d74768973d85
address
bc1qsyx7txjxzg4xkh7cqky8rcwhga5fw0v947e9rj
transaction
58b8266e4eb4680f340c1455a4ec3373afcf8471bcf9ff28f3e97d36a7a5a02b
spent
true